在数控攻丝编程中,G99指令用于控制攻丝刀具在完成攻丝操作后如何回到初始位置,以便进行下一次攻丝操作。G99指令通常用于钻孔、攻丝、镗孔等操作中,它告诉数控机床在钻孔操作中返回到第一个钻孔位置。
具体的编程格式如下:
```
G99 F R
```
其中:
`G99` 是指令代码,表示使用G99指令进行进给速度的设定。
`F` 表示进给速度,单位通常是毫米/分钟或英寸/分钟。
`R` 表示进给方式,可以是切向进给方式或径向进给方式。
```
N010 M4 SI000;(主轴开始旋转)
N020 G90 G99 G74 X300-150.0 R -100.0 P15 F120.0;(定位,攻丝2,然后返回到尺点)
N030 Y-550.0.(定位,攻丝1,然后返回到尺点)
N040 Y -750.0;(定位,攻丝3,然后返回到尺点)
N050 X1000.0;(定位,攻丝4,然后返回到点)
N060 Y-550.0;(定位攻丝5,然后返回到R点)
N070 G98 V-750.0;(定位攻丝6,然后返回到初始平面)
N080 C80 G28 C91 X0 Y0 Z0 ;(返回到参考点)
N090 M05;(主轴停止旋转)
```
在这个示例中,G99指令被用于在每次攻丝操作后返回到起始位置,以便进行连续的攻丝加工。
建议在实际编程中,根据具体的加工需求和机床类型,调整G99指令的参数,以确保加工过程的顺利进行和加工精度。